How to Express Gratitude

Expressing gratitude is a vital aspect of maintaining healthy relationships and promoting personal well-being. Here are some effective ways to express gratitude:

1. Verbal Appreciation

Simply saying thank you can go a long way. Make your appreciation specific by mentioning what the person did that you are grateful for. For example, Thank you for helping me with my project your insights were invaluable.

2. Written Notes

Consider writing a thank-you note. A handwritten message can convey sincerity and thoughtfulness. It can be particularly meaningful for special occasions or significant acts of kindness.

3. Acts of Kindness

Show your gratitude through actions. This could be as simple as offering to help the person in return or surprising them with a small gift or gesture that reflects their interests.

4. Public Recognition

Recognizing someone’s efforts publicly can be a powerful way to express gratitude. This could be done in a meeting, on social media, or through a community event.

5. Quality Time

Spending time with the person you appreciate is another meaningful way to express gratitude. It shows that you value them and their contributions to your life.

In conclusion, expressing gratitude is essential for nurturing relationships and enhancing your emotional health. By incorporating these practices into your daily life, you can foster a culture of appreciation and positivity.
